Thermal Conductivity Gas Sensor Amphenol VQ6MB Element Designed for Direct PCB Mounting Applications
Product Overview The VQ6 Series Thermal Conductivity Gas Detector Elements are designed for detecting gases in 0 100% by volume concentrations. Utilizing the thermal conductivity principle, these elements feature a sensing element exposed to the atmosphere under test and a reference element sealed in reference air. Gas detection sensor Amphenol VQ3BJ catalytic pellistor for monitoring flammable gas concentrations
Product Overview The SGX Sensortech VQ3 is a catalytic flammable gas sensor, also known as a pellistor, designed for detecting a wide range of combustible gases in air. It operates within concentrations from 0% to 100% of the Lower Explosive Limit (LEL) for a given gas. The VQ3 is an established, general-purpose sensor for fixed gas detection systems, prioritizing low cost and stability. MEMS thermal conductivity sensor Amphenol TC1326-AS optimized for hydrogen and methane gas detection
Product Overview The SGX Sensortech TC-1326 is a low-power, robust MEMS thermal conductivity sensor specifically designed for detecting hydrogen due to its high thermal conductivity. It is optimized for hydrogen and methane detection (0-100% volume in air) but can also detect other gases with a sufficient thermal conductivity difference compared to air.
